Chemistry Teacher centers on building a strong conceptual foundation in chemical principles, fostering scientific curiosity, and preparing students for higher-level competitive exams like NEET, IIT-JEE.
Key Responsibilities
- Instruction & Curriculum Delivery: Deliver engaging and high-quality chemistry lessons to middle and secondary school students.
- Conceptual Mastery: Focus on building strong foundations in fundamental topics (e.g., structure of atoms, chemical reactions, periodic table).
- Competitive Preparation: Introduce foundational strategies for NEET/JEE, Olympiads, NTSE, and other entrance exams.
- Practical Work: Conduct lab sessions, demonstrate experiments, and ensure safety protocols are followed.
- Assessment & Doubt Resolution: Create and grade assignments, tests, and mock exams, and provide one-on-one doubt-clearing sessions.
- Student Progress Monitoring: Track student academic growth, maintain records, and provide regular feedback to parents.
- Content Development: Design practice sheets, study materials, and innovative teaching methods, such as visual aids or interactive sessions.
Required Qualifications & Skills
- Education: A Master’s (M.Sc.) or Bachelor’s degree (B.Sc./B.Ed.) in Chemistry or a related field.
- Subject Knowledge: In-depth understanding of organic, inorganic, and physical chemistry concepts.
- Communication: Excellent verbal and written skills, capable of explaining complex concepts clearly.
- Passion for Teaching: A patient, enthusiastic, and student-centric approach.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in using educational technology, digital tools, or online platforms.
